This picture taken on February 8, 2023 shows coconut farmer Hastoma (front R) and other farmers, whose lands were illegally taken by Gema Kreasi Perdana (GKP), looking at a nickel mining site operated by the company on Wawonii island, southeast Sulawesi. The dig site is part of a huge rush to Indonesia, the world's largest nickel producer, by domestic and foreign enterprises to mine the critical component used in electric vehicle batteries. Participants parade with heaps of durians during the “Kenduren” festival in Jombang, East Java on March 5, 2023. The annual festival, held as thanksgiving for the good harvest of the fruit, attracts many tourists from the region. Grown across tropical Southeast Asia, the durian is hailed as the “king of fruits” by its fans who liken its creamy texture and intense aroma to blue cheese, but many detractors liken their intense aroma to sewage or sweaty socks. Worker uses his equipment at the construction site of the new capital city in Penajam Paser Utara, East Kalimantan, Indonesia, Wednesday, March 8, 2023. Indonesia began construction of the new capital in mid 2022, after President Joko Widodo announced that Jakarta – the congested, polluted current capital that is prone to earthquakes and rapidly sinking into the Java Sea — would be retired from capital status.
